Harry Clifford Taylor
ZANESVILLE
-
Harry Clifford Taylor, 84, Zanesville, longtime area businessman and
former owner of C.W. Taylor & Sons Inc. (Construction Company),
passed away at 3:59 p.m. Saturday July 21, 2007 at Genesis Good
Samaritan Emergency Room.
Harry
was born in Zanesville on Jan. 28, 1923 to the late Charles Walter
and Bessie Barnett Taylor. Harry was a member of Central
Presbyterian Church, Homebuilders, Zanesville Jaycees, Zanesville
Ducks Unlimited, and Zanesville Country Club. Harry served our
country and protected our freedom by serving in the US Army under
the direction of General Patton during WWII. Harry was a very big
supporter of the B-17 Sentimental Journey that flies into Zanesville
annually.
